P\u0159\u00edli\u0161 mal\u00fd moment znamen\u00e1 nedostate\u010dn\u00e9 p\u0159edp\u011bt\u00ed a riziko povolen\u00ed spoje vibracemi, p\u0159\u00edli\u0161 velk\u00fd moment naopak \u0161roub p\u0159et\u00ed\u017e\u00ed, nat\u00e1hne za mez kluzu nebo utrhne. V tomto \u010dl\u00e1nku najdete <strong>orienta\u010dn\u00ed tabulku utahovac\u00edch moment\u016f<\/strong> pro b\u011b\u017en\u00e9 pr\u016fm\u011bry M6 a\u017e M20 a pevnostn\u00ed t\u0159\u00eddy 8.8, 10.9 i nerez A2-70, spolu s vysv\u011btlen\u00edm, pro\u010d na maz\u00e1n\u00ed z\u00e1vitu opravdu z\u00e1le\u017e\u00ed.<\/p>\n<h2>Co je utahovac\u00ed moment a p\u0159edp\u011bt\u00ed<\/h2>\n<p>Kdy\u017e utahujete \u0161roub, vyvozujete v n\u011bm tahovou s\u00edlu &ndash; takzvan\u00e9 <strong>p\u0159edp\u011bt\u00ed<\/strong> (anglicky <em>preload<\/em> nebo <em>clamp load<\/em>). Pr\u00e1v\u011b toto p\u0159edp\u011bt\u00ed dr\u017e\u00ed spoj pohromad\u011b a br\u00e1n\u00ed povolen\u00ed. Utahovac\u00ed moment (v Nm) je jen <em>nep\u0159\u00edm\u00fd n\u00e1stroj<\/em>, jak po\u017eadovan\u00e9 p\u0159edp\u011bt\u00ed dos\u00e1hnout: to\u010divou silou na kl\u00ed\u010di p\u0159ekon\u00e1v\u00e1te t\u0159en\u00ed a \u0161roub natahujete.<\/p>\n<p>Probl\u00e9m je, \u017ee naprost\u00e1 v\u011bt\u0161ina vynalo\u017een\u00e9ho momentu se spot\u0159ebuje na t\u0159en\u00ed, nikoli na nata\u017een\u00ed \u0161roubu. Z celkov\u00e9ho momentu se zhruba <strong>polovina ztrat\u00ed t\u0159en\u00edm pod hlavou (resp. matic\u00ed)<\/strong>, dal\u0161\u00edch p\u0159ibli\u017en\u011b <strong>40 % t\u0159en\u00edm v z\u00e1vitu<\/strong> a jen kolem <strong>10 %<\/strong> se re\u00e1ln\u011b p\u0159em\u011bn\u00ed na u\u017eite\u010dn\u00e9 nata\u017een\u00ed \u0161roubu. Proto je t\u0159en\u00ed &ndash; a tedy i maz\u00e1n\u00ed &ndash; tak z\u00e1sadn\u00ed.<\/p>\n<h2>Orienta\u010dn\u00ed tabulka utahovac\u00edch moment\u016f<\/h2>\n<p>N\u00e1sleduj\u00edc\u00ed hodnoty plat\u00ed pro metrick\u00fd hrub\u00fd z\u00e1vit, koeficient t\u0159en\u00ed p\u0159ibli\u017en\u011b <strong>\u03bc = 0,14<\/strong> (b\u011b\u017en\u00fd m\u00edrn\u011b mazan\u00fd nebo pozinkovan\u00fd stav) a vyu\u017eit\u00ed cca 90 % meze kluzu. Jde o <strong>orienta\u010dn\u00ed hodnoty<\/strong> &ndash; v\u017edy ov\u011b\u0159te konkr\u00e9tn\u00ed doporu\u010den\u00ed v\u00fdrobce, normu spoje a stav z\u00e1vitu.<\/p>\n<table border=\"1\" cellpadding=\"6\" cellspacing=\"0\">\n<thead>\n<tr>\n<th>Z\u00e1vit<\/th>\n<th>T\u0159\u00edda 8.8 (Nm)<\/th>\n<th>T\u0159\u00edda 10.9 (Nm)<\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td>M6<\/td>\n<td>10<\/td>\n<td>14<\/td>\n<\/tr>\n<tr>\n<td>M8<\/td>\n<td>25<\/td>\n<td>36<\/td>\n<\/tr>\n<tr>\n<td>M10<\/td>\n<td>46<\/td>\n<td>67<\/td>\n<\/tr>\n<tr>\n<td>M12<\/td>\n<td>82<\/td>\n<td>120<\/td>\n<\/tr>\n<tr>\n<td>M16<\/td>\n<td>206<\/td>\n<td>302<\/td>\n<\/tr>\n<tr>\n<td>M20<\/td>\n<td>407<\/td>\n<td>580<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p class=\"note\"><em>Pozn.: Hodnoty jsou orienta\u010dn\u00ed (\u03bc = 0,14). P\u0159i jin\u00e9m t\u0159en\u00ed se mohou v\u00fdrazn\u011b li\u0161it.<\/em><\/p>\n<h2>Nerezov\u00e9 \u0161rouby A2-70 a A4-70 maj\u00ed jin\u00e9 momenty<\/h2>\n<p>Nerezov\u00e9 \u0161rouby v pevnostn\u00ed t\u0159\u00edd\u011b 70 (A2-70, A4-70) odpov\u00eddaj\u00ed zhruba pevnostn\u00ed \u00farovni mezi t\u0159\u00eddami 8.8. Maj\u00ed ale <strong>v\u00fdrazn\u011b vy\u0161\u0161\u00ed sklon k zad\u00edr\u00e1n\u00ed (galling)<\/strong> &ndash; zejm\u00e9na p\u0159i rychl\u00e9m utahov\u00e1n\u00ed, pou\u017eit\u00ed r\u00e1zov\u00fdch utahov\u00e1k\u016f nebo bez maz\u00e1n\u00ed. Proto se pro nerez pou\u017e\u00edvaj\u00ed ni\u017e\u0161\u00ed a opatrn\u011bj\u0161\u00ed momenty:<\/p>\n<table border=\"1\" cellpadding=\"6\" cellspacing=\"0\">\n<thead>\n<tr>\n<th>Z\u00e1vit<\/th>\n<th>A2-70 \/ A4-70 (Nm, orienta\u010dn\u011b)<\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td>M6<\/td>\n<td>~7<\/td>\n<\/tr>\n<tr>\n<td>M8<\/td>\n<td>~17<\/td>\n<\/tr>\n<tr>\n<td>M10<\/td>\n<td>~33<\/td>\n<\/tr>\n<tr>\n<td>M12<\/td>\n<td>~57<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p>U nerezu d\u016frazn\u011b doporu\u010dujeme <strong>z\u00e1vit mazat<\/strong> (pasta proti zad\u00edr\u00e1n\u00ed, MoS\u2082) a utahovat pomalu, ide\u00e1ln\u011b momentov\u00fdm kl\u00ed\u010dem, nikoli r\u00e1zov\u00fdm utahov\u00e1kem. K p\u0159enosu p\u0159edp\u011bt\u00ed p\u0159es matici s\u00e1hn\u011bte po odpov\u00eddaj\u00edc\u00edch <a href=\"\/spojovaci-material\/matice\/\">matic\u00edch A4<\/a>.<\/p>\n<h2>Such\u00fd vs mazan\u00fd z\u00e1vit: rozd\u00edl je obrovsk\u00fd<\/h2>\n<p>Maz\u00e1n\u00ed je nej\u010dast\u011bj\u0161\u00ed p\u0159\u00ed\u010dinou rozd\u00edlu mezi teoretick\u00fdm a skute\u010dn\u00fdm p\u0159edp\u011bt\u00edm. Plat\u00ed jednoduch\u00e9 pravidlo:<\/p>\n<ul>\n<li><strong>Mazan\u00fd z\u00e1vit dos\u00e1hne p\u0159i stejn\u00e9m momentu vy\u0161\u0161\u00edho p\u0159edp\u011bt\u00ed<\/strong> &ndash; t\u0159en\u00ed je ni\u017e\u0161\u00ed, tak\u017ee v\u00edce momentu jde do nata\u017een\u00ed \u0161roubu. Mazan\u00fd spoj vyvine p\u0159ibli\u017en\u011b o 50&ndash;70 % vy\u0161\u0161\u00ed tah ne\u017e such\u00fd.<\/li>\n<li><strong>Pokud aplikujete moment ur\u010den\u00fd pro such\u00fd stav na namazan\u00fd \u0161roub, v\u00fdrazn\u011b jej p\u0159et\u00ed\u017e\u00edte<\/strong> &ndash; m\u016f\u017eete jej nat\u00e1hnout za mez kluzu nebo utrhnout.<\/li>\n<li>Naopak such\u00fd, zrezl\u00fd nebo zne\u010di\u0161t\u011bn\u00fd z\u00e1vit p\u0159i stejn\u00e9m momentu p\u0159edp\u011bt\u00ed <em>nedos\u00e1hne<\/em> a spoj z\u016fstane povolen\u00fd.<\/li>\n<\/ul>\n<p>Orienta\u010dn\u011b se pro lehce naolejovan\u00fd nebo pokoven\u00fd spoj momenty z tabulky sni\u017euj\u00ed p\u0159ibli\u017en\u011b na <strong>75 %<\/strong> (n\u00e1sobek 0,75) oproti such\u00e9mu stavu. Kl\u00ed\u010dov\u00e9 pravidlo zn\u00ed: <strong>nikdy nem\u00edchejte mazan\u00fd moment se such\u00fdm \u0161roubem a naopak.<\/strong><\/p>\n<h2>Co ovliv\u0148uje skute\u010dn\u00fd moment<\/h2>\n<p>Souhrnn\u011b do hodnoty momentu zasahuje takzvan\u00fd <em>nut factor<\/em> (K-faktor), kter\u00fd kombinuje:<\/p>\n<ul>\n<li>t\u0159en\u00ed v z\u00e1vitu a pod hlavou\/matic\u00ed,<\/li>\n<li>povrchovou \u00fapravu (pozink, zinek-lamela, hol\u00fd kov),<\/li>\n<li>p\u0159\u00edtomnost a typ maziva (such\u00fd ~ K 0,20; pasta MoS\u2082 ~ K 0,13),<\/li>\n<li>pou\u017eit\u00ed podlo\u017eky a jej\u00ed povrch,<\/li>\n<li>stav z\u00e1vitu (nov\u00e9, opot\u0159eben\u00e9, korodovan\u00e9).<\/li>\n<\/ul>\n<p>U kritick\u00fdch spoj\u016f proto profesion\u00e1lov\u00e9 ov\u011b\u0159uj\u00ed p\u0159edp\u011bt\u00ed p\u0159esn\u011bj\u0161\u00edmi metodami (m\u011b\u0159en\u00ed prodlou\u017een\u00ed \u0161roubu, \u00fahlov\u00e9 dotahov\u00e1n\u00ed za mez kluzu). Tabulka moment\u016f je v\u00fdborn\u00e9 vod\u00edtko pro b\u011b\u017enou mont\u00e1\u017e, ale nen\u00ed absolutn\u00ed jistotou.<\/p>\n<h2>Jak postupovat p\u0159i utahov\u00e1n\u00ed v praxi<\/h2>\n<p>Samotn\u00e1 spr\u00e1vn\u00e1 hodnota momentu nesta\u010d\u00ed &ndash; z\u00e1le\u017e\u00ed i na technice. U v\u00edce\u0161roubov\u00fdch spoj\u016f (p\u0159\u00edruby, kola, hlavy) utahujte <strong>k\u0159\u00ed\u017eov\u011b (do hv\u011bzdy)<\/strong> a v n\u011bkolika kroc\u00edch, typicky na 30 %, 60 % a nakonec 100 % c\u00edlov\u00e9ho momentu. Postupn\u00e9 a rovnom\u011brn\u00e9 utahov\u00e1n\u00ed zajist\u00ed, \u017ee se p\u0159edp\u011bt\u00ed rozlo\u017e\u00ed rovnom\u011brn\u011b a spojovan\u00e9 d\u00edly nedosednou nak\u0159ivo.<\/p>\n<p>Pozor tak\u00e9 na <strong>usazen\u00ed spoje<\/strong> (setting\/embedding): po prvn\u00edm uta\u017een\u00ed se mikronerovnosti dosedac\u00edch ploch a z\u00e1vitu \u201eule\u017e\u00ed\u201c a p\u0159edp\u011bt\u00ed m\u00edrn\u011b poklesne. U d\u016fle\u017eit\u00fdch spoj\u016f je proto vhodn\u00e9 po kr\u00e1tk\u00e9 dob\u011b nebo po prvn\u00edm zat\u00ed\u017een\u00ed dota\u017een\u00ed zkontrolovat. U spoj\u016f nam\u00e1han\u00fdch vibracemi nav\u00edc zva\u017ete zaji\u0161t\u011bn\u00ed proti povolen\u00ed &ndash; pojistn\u00e9 podlo\u017eky, samojistic\u00ed matice s nylonov\u00fdm krou\u017ekem nebo zaji\u0161\u0165ovac\u00ed lepidlo na z\u00e1vit.<\/p>\n<p>Rozd\u00edl mezi pevnostn\u00edmi t\u0159\u00eddami nen\u00ed jen v dovolen\u00e9m momentu, ale i v chov\u00e1n\u00ed p\u0159i p\u0159et\u00ed\u017een\u00ed. T\u0159\u00edda 8.8 m\u00e1 ni\u017e\u0161\u00ed mez pevnosti, ale je hou\u017eevnat\u011bj\u0161\u00ed; t\u0159\u00edda 10.9 unese vy\u0161\u0161\u00ed p\u0159edp\u011bt\u00ed, je v\u0161ak citliv\u011bj\u0161\u00ed na vruby a kvalitu mont\u00e1\u017ee. Pevnostn\u00ed t\u0159\u00eddu proto nevyb\u00edrejte jen podle \u201e\u010d\u00edm vy\u0161\u0161\u00ed, t\u00edm lep\u0161\u00ed\u201c, ale podle skute\u010dn\u00e9ho nam\u00e1h\u00e1n\u00ed spoje.<\/p>\n<h2>\u010cast\u00e9 chyby p\u0159i utahov\u00e1n\u00ed<\/h2>\n<ul>\n<li><strong>R\u00e1zov\u00fd utahov\u00e1k bez kontroly<\/strong> &ndash; rychle a nekontrolovan\u011b p\u0159eto\u010d\u00ed \u0161roub, u nerezu nav\u00edc zp\u016fsob\u00ed zad\u0159en\u00ed. Pro fin\u00e1ln\u00ed dota\u017een\u00ed pou\u017e\u00edvejte momentov\u00fd kl\u00ed\u010d.<\/li>\n<li><strong>Pou\u017eit\u00ed such\u00e9ho momentu na mazan\u00fd \u0161roub<\/strong> &ndash; nej\u010dast\u011bj\u0161\u00ed p\u0159\u00ed\u010dina utr\u017een\u00ed; mazan\u00fd spoj dos\u00e1hne stejn\u00e9ho p\u0159edp\u011bt\u00ed p\u0159i ni\u017e\u0161\u00edm momentu.<\/li>\n<li><strong>Dotahov\u00e1n\u00ed zrezl\u00e9ho nebo po\u0161kozen\u00e9ho z\u00e1vitu<\/strong> &ndash; t\u0159en\u00ed je nep\u0159edv\u00eddateln\u00e9 a moment neodpov\u00edd\u00e1 skute\u010dn\u00e9mu p\u0159edp\u011bt\u00ed.<\/li>\n<li><strong>Opomenut\u00ed podlo\u017eky<\/strong> &ndash; podlo\u017eka rozkl\u00e1d\u00e1 tlak pod hlavou a stabilizuje t\u0159en\u00ed; jej\u00ed absence m\u011bn\u00ed v\u00fdsledn\u00e9 p\u0159edp\u011bt\u00ed.<\/li>\n<\/ul>\n<h2>Praktick\u00e1 doporu\u010den\u00ed<\/h2>\n<ul>\n<li>Pou\u017e\u00edvejte <strong>kalibrovan\u00fd momentov\u00fd kl\u00ed\u010d<\/strong>, ne odhad \u201eod ruky\u201c.<\/li>\n<li>U nerezu v\u017edy <strong>ma\u017ete<\/strong> a utahujte pomalu, abyste p\u0159ede\u0161li zad\u0159en\u00ed.<\/li>\n<li>Ov\u011b\u0159te, zda v\u00fdrobce neud\u00e1v\u00e1 konkr\u00e9tn\u00ed moment &ndash; ten m\u00e1 v\u017edy p\u0159ednost p\u0159ed obecnou tabulkou.<\/li>\n<li>Pro v\u00fdb\u011br spr\u00e1vn\u00e9 pevnostn\u00ed t\u0159\u00eddy si p\u0159e\u010dt\u011bte <a href=\"\/blog\/trida-pevnosti-8-8\/\">vysv\u011btlen\u00ed pevnostn\u00ed t\u0159\u00eddy 8.8<\/a> a pro orientaci v sortimentu <a href=\"\/blog\/jak-vybrat-spojovaci-material\/\">jak vybrat spojovac\u00ed materi\u00e1l<\/a>.<\/li>\n<li>Pro n\u00e1ro\u010dn\u00e9 nebo korozn\u00ed prost\u0159ed\u00ed zva\u017ete rozd\u00edl mezi materi\u00e1ly v \u010dl\u00e1nku <a href=\"\/blog\/nerez-a2-vs-a4\/\">nerez A2 vs A4<\/a>.<\/li>\n<\/ul>\n<h2>\u010cast\u00e9 dotazy<\/h2>\n<h3>Jak\u00fd je utahovac\u00ed moment \u0161roubu M10 t\u0159\u00eddy 8.8?<\/h3>\n<p>Orienta\u010dn\u011b p\u0159ibli\u017en\u011b 46 Nm p\u0159i koeficientu t\u0159en\u00ed \u03bc = 0,14 (m\u00edrn\u011b mazan\u00fd stav). Hodnota se m\u011bn\u00ed podle maz\u00e1n\u00ed a povrchov\u00e9 \u00fapravy \u2013 u such\u00e9ho z\u00e1vitu je vy\u0161\u0161\u00ed, u dob\u0159e namazan\u00e9ho ni\u017e\u0161\u00ed. Pro M10 ve t\u0159\u00edd\u011b 10.9 je to orienta\u010dn\u011b 67 Nm.<\/p>\n<h3>M\u00e1m utahovat z\u00e1vit nasucho, nebo namazan\u00fd?<\/h3>\n<p>Z\u00e1le\u017e\u00ed na tom, k jak\u00e9mu stavu se vztahuje pou\u017eit\u00fd moment. Mazan\u00fd z\u00e1vit dos\u00e1hne p\u0159i stejn\u00e9m momentu vy\u0161\u0161\u00edho p\u0159edp\u011bt\u00ed. Pokud pou\u017eijete moment ur\u010den\u00fd pro such\u00fd stav na namazan\u00fd \u0161roub, hroz\u00ed p\u0159et\u00ed\u017een\u00ed a utr\u017een\u00ed. V\u017edy pou\u017e\u00edvejte moment odpov\u00eddaj\u00edc\u00ed stavu z\u00e1vitu.<\/p>\n<h3>Pro\u010d maj\u00ed nerezov\u00e9 \u0161rouby A2-70 ni\u017e\u0161\u00ed momenty?<\/h3>\n<p>Nerez m\u00e1 siln\u00fd sklon k zad\u00edr\u00e1n\u00ed (galling). Ni\u017e\u0161\u00ed momenty a pomal\u00e9 utahov\u00e1n\u00ed s mazivem sni\u017euj\u00ed riziko, \u017ee se z\u00e1vit p\u0159i mont\u00e1\u017ei zad\u0159e a znehodnot\u00ed. Nerezov\u00e9 \u0161rouby proto v\u017edy ma\u017ete pastou proti zad\u00edr\u00e1n\u00ed a neutahujte r\u00e1zov\u00fdm utahov\u00e1kem.<\/p>\n<h3>Jsou tabulkov\u00e9 momenty p\u0159esn\u00e9?<\/h3>\n<p>Ne, jsou orienta\u010dn\u00ed. Skute\u010dn\u00fd moment z\u00e1vis\u00ed na t\u0159en\u00ed, maz\u00e1n\u00ed, povrchov\u00e9 \u00faprav\u011b a stavu z\u00e1vitu (tzv. K-faktor). U b\u011b\u017en\u00e9 mont\u00e1\u017ee tabulka dob\u0159e poslou\u017e\u00ed, u kritick\u00fdch spoj\u016f se p\u0159edp\u011bt\u00ed ov\u011b\u0159uje p\u0159esn\u011bj\u0161\u00edmi metodami nebo se \u0159\u00edd\u00ed p\u0159\u00edmo \u00fadajem v\u00fdrobce.<\/p>\n<h3>Co se stane p\u0159i p\u0159eta\u017een\u00ed \u0161roubu?<\/h3>\n<p>\u0160roub se nat\u00e1hne za mez kluzu, trvale se prodlou\u017e\u00ed a ztrat\u00ed p\u0159edp\u011bt\u00ed, nebo se p\u0159\u00edmo utrhne. Tak\u00e9 se m\u016f\u017ee po\u0161kodit z\u00e1vit \u010di deformovat spojovan\u00fd materi\u00e1l. Proto pou\u017e\u00edvejte momentov\u00fd kl\u00ed\u010d a hodnotu odpov\u00eddaj\u00edc\u00ed t\u0159\u00edd\u011b, pr\u016fm\u011bru a stavu z\u00e1vitu.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>Orienta\u010dn\u00ed tabulka utahovac\u00edch moment\u016f \u0161roub\u016f M6\u2013M20 pro t\u0159\u00eddy 8.8, 10.9 a nerez A2-70.
